Cara Menjadi Front-end Developer

Langkah-Langkah Menjadi Front-end Developer yang Andal

Cara menjadi front-end developer memang tidak hanya sekadar mempelajari bahasa pemrograman dan desain antarmuka. Di era digital yang terus berkembang pesat ini, seorang front-end developer dituntut untuk memiliki pemahaman yang mendalam tentang pengalaman pengguna (user experience) dan antarmuka pengguna (user interface) yang efektif. Dengan kombinasi keterampilan teknis dan kreativitas, profesi ini menjadi salah satu yang paling diminati dalam industri teknologi.

Dengan semakin meluasnya penggunaan website, pergeseran dari media cetak ke portal berita online menjadi salah satu contoh nyata dari perubahan yang terjadi. Pekerjaan sebagai front-end developer tidak hanya berfokus pada pengembangan dan desain website, tetapi juga berkontribusi dalam menciptakan pengalaman pengguna yang menarik dan interaktif.

Seiring dengan kemajuan teknologi dan tingginya permintaan akan website yang fungsional, profesi ini menawarkan peluang yang luas. Bagi Anda yang berminat untuk mengetahui lebih dalam tentang cara menjadi front-end developer, pekerjaan ini tidak hanya menjanjikan pendapatan yang kompetitif, tetapi juga memberikan kesempatan untuk mengembangkan keterampilan dan pengalaman di bidang teknologi yang terus berkembang.

Untuk memahami lebih lanjut mengenai front-end developer dan cara menjadi front-end developer, simak ulasannya berikut ini:

1. Pelajari Dasar-dasar Web Development

  • HTML (HyperText Markup Language): Mulailah dengan menguasai HTML, bahasa markup yang digunakan untuk membuat struktur dasar halaman web. HTML memungkinkan Anda membuat elemen-elemen seperti judul, paragraf, tautan, dan gambar di situs web.
  • CSS (Cascading Style Sheets): Setelah memahami HTML, pelajari CSS untuk mendesain dan mengatur tampilan halaman web. CSS memungkinkan Anda mengubah tata letak, warna, font, dan aspek visual lainnya untuk menciptakan desain yang menarik dan responsif.
  • JavaScript: Kuasailah JavaScript, salah satu bahasa pemrograman yang memungkinkan Anda untuk menambahkan interaktivitas ke halaman web. Dengan JavaScript, Anda dapat membuat halaman lebih dinamis, seperti memvalidasi formulir atau membuat animasi.

2. Pelajari Framework dan Library

  • CSS Frameworks (Bootstrap, Tailwind CSS): Untuk mempercepat pengembangan front-end, pelajari framework seperti Bootstrap atau Tailwind CSS. Framework ini membantu Anda membuat tata letak yang responsif dan mendesain elemen web tanpa harus menulis CSS dari awal.
  • JavaScript Frameworks (React, Angular, Vue.js): Pelajari JavaScript frameworks seperti React, Angular, atau Vue.js yang banyak digunakan untuk mengembangkan aplikasi web interaktif dengan kode yang lebih efisien. Framework ini sangat populer di dunia front-end development dan sering dibutuhkan dalam banyak proyek modern.

3. Pahami Version Control (Git)

  • Git dan GitHub: Git adalah alat version control yang memungkinkan Anda mengelola dan melacak perubahan kode secara efisien. GitHub digunakan untuk menyimpan proyek secara online, memungkinkan kolaborasi dengan tim, dan memberikan portofolio kode Anda kepada calon pemberi kerja.

4. Pahami Prinsip Responsivitas dan Desain Adaptif

  • Responsivitas (Responsive Design): Pastikan Anda mempelajari prinsip desain responsif, yang memungkinkan situs web beradaptasi dengan baik di berbagai perangkat dan ukuran layar. Anda dapat menggunakan media queries di CSS untuk mengubah tampilan sesuai perangkat.
  • Mobile-First Approach: Desain web yang mobile-first adalah pendekatan di mana Anda merancang antarmuka terlebih dahulu untuk perangkat mobile, kemudian menyesuaikannya untuk layar yang lebih besar. Ini penting karena mayoritas pengguna mengakses web melalui perangkat mobile.

5. Pelajari Tools Pengembangan Front-End

  • Text Editor/IDE (Visual Studio Code, Sublime Text): Gunakan editor teks atau IDE yang mendukung pengembangan web dengan baik, seperti Visual Studio Code atau Sublime Text, yang menyediakan fitur seperti sintaks highlighting, integrasi Git, dan beragam plugin yang mempermudah pengembangan.
  • DevTools Browser: Pelajari penggunaan DevTools di browser seperti Google Chrome atau Mozilla Firefox. Alat ini memungkinkan Anda untuk memeriksa, memodifikasi, dan debug HTML, CSS, dan JavaScript secara langsung di browser.

Baca juga: 10 Pertanyaan Interview Programmer yang Wajib Dikuasai

6. Bangun Portofolio Proyek

  • Proyek Sederhana: Mulailah dengan membangun proyek sederhana seperti halaman web statis, form interaktif, atau portofolio pribadi. Ini akan memberi Anda pengalaman praktis dalam mengaplikasikan keterampilan yang telah dipelajari.
  • Proyek Nyata: Setelah merasa lebih percaya diri, buat proyek yang lebih besar dan relevan dengan kebutuhan industri, seperti aplikasi web sederhana dengan React atau Vue.js. Ini akan membantu Anda membuat portofolio yang menarik bagi calon pemberi kerja.

7. Terus Belajar dan Beradaptasi

  • Tetap Belajar: Teknologi dalam front-end development terus berkembang, jadi penting untuk selalu mengikuti tren terbaru. Ikuti blog teknologi, tonton video tutorial, dan baca dokumentasi terbaru dari tools dan framework yang Anda gunakan.
  • Gabung Komunitas: Bergabung dengan komunitas pengembang, baik itu melalui forum, grup media sosial, atau acara meetups, memungkinkan Anda bertukar ide, belajar dari pengalaman orang lain, dan memperluas jaringan profesional Anda.

8. Pelajari Prinsip UI/UX (User Interface/User Experience)

  • UI/UX Design: Sebagai front-end developer, memahami prinsip UI/UX akan membantu Anda menciptakan antarmuka yang tidak hanya terlihat baik tetapi juga mudah digunakan. Pahami alur pengguna, konsistensi desain, serta cara membuat navigasi yang intuitif dan efisien.

9. Perkuat Kemampuan Komunikasi dan Kolaborasi

  • Kolaborasi dengan Tim: Front-end developer sering bekerja bersama tim, termasuk back-end developer, desainer, dan project manager. Mengembangkan keterampilan komunikasi yang baik akan mempermudah Anda dalam bekerja secara efektif di lingkungan kolaboratif.
  • Dokumentasi: Biasakan untuk menulis dokumentasi yang jelas dan terorganisir, baik untuk diri sendiri maupun tim lain, agar memudahkan pemeliharaan dan pengembangan lebih lanjut dari proyek yang Anda kerjakan.

10. Cari Peluang Magang atau Proyek Freelance

  • Magang atau Freelance: Jika Anda baru memulai, cari peluang magang atau proyek freelance untuk mendapatkan pengalaman langsung. Ini adalah cara bagus untuk membangun jaringan, mengasah keterampilan, dan mempersiapkan diri untuk karier profesional sebagai front-end developer.

Nah, itu tadi ulasan mengenai cara menjadi front-end developer yang dapat Anda ikuti untuk memulai karier di bidang ini. Dengan mempelajari keterampilan dasar, menguasai alat dan framework yang relevan, serta terus beradaptasi dengan perkembangan teknologi, Anda akan lebih siap untuk menghadapi tantangan dalam dunia pengembangan web.

Jangan lupa untuk membangun portofolio yang mencerminkan kemampuan Anda dan terus terlibat dalam komunitas pengembang untuk mendapatkan dukungan dan inspirasi. Semoga sukses dalam perjalanan Anda menjadi front-end developer!

Klik di bawah ini untuk informasi layanan kami selengkapnya

Leave a Reply

Your email address will not be published. Required fields are marked *